EU countries offer study opportunities for students from Kosovo (RTKLive)

The Croatian and Finnish embassies in Kosovo, during am Education Fair held in Pristina on the occasion of Europe Day, offered different training programs for students from Kosovo.  The education fair, although open for only two hours, has managed to attract a lot of attention from students who think that studying abroad is the best option. Dafina Zherka, Information Officer at the EU Information Center, said that this exhibition aims to inform the Kosovo students to study abroad. “The fair with representatives of EU member states, namely embassies, is happening within the Europe Day celebration, which is held on 9 May.  The fair aims to provide information to Kosovar students who have an interest in studying abroad. Embassies’ representative at the fair presented their programs for study abroad, in order to show what are they offering, which study programs they have available, and to provide more specific information for all students interested,” Zherka said.
